Darin Brooks talks about starring in ‘Amber Brown’ on Apple TV+

Emmy award-winning actor Darin Brooks chatted about starring as Max in “Amber Brown” on Apple TV+.

Based on the children’s book series by Paula Danziger, it was created by, written by, and directed by Bonnie Hunt, who also served as a co-executive producer. “I was so excited when I found out that Bonnie Hunt was a part of this because I love Bonnie,” he said. “We also need to give props to the books by Paula Danzinger.”

“Doing ‘Amber Brown’ has been great,” Brooks admitted. “I can’t believe it has been almost a year since we shot it in Utah with the amazing Bonnie Hunt.” “It was such a fun show to shoot, it was great,” he said, and he praised the entire cast of actors that he worked with on this project.

Aside from Darin Brooks as Max, “Amber Brown” stars Carsyn Rose in the title role of Amber Brown, Sarah Drew as Sarah Brown, Ashley Williams as Aunt Pam, Michael Yo as Philip, and Liliana Inouye as Brandi.

“Playing Max was great, he’s a fun character to play,” he said. “I play mom’s boyfriend that is coming in to win over the affections of Amber Brown and sort of step in and take care of her and the family. It’s a fun balance. Max is a health nut and I am very health conscious myself in my personal life so it is neat how life imitated art. He has a lot of eccentric qualities to him too, which I love to play in all of my characters. It was a blast.”

Brooks proclaimed protagonist Carsyn Rose as a “star in the making.” “Carsyn is so good, entertaining, and engaging. She was the perfect lead for this show,” he said. “She has the comedy, the heart, and the drama. She is just doing it right. I am super excited to see where her career goes.”

“Ashley was amazing, we joked around the whole time. She is great and super funny. She is so talented and smart,” he said.

The synopsis of the series is as follows: Growing up is a work of art. “Amber Brown” follows a young girl finding her voice through music and art in the wake of her mother and father’s divorce and her best friend moving away. “Amber Brown” will be released globally on Friday, July 29 on Apple TV+

The trailer of “Amber Brown” may be seen below.

“Honestly, I am so proud of this show,” he said about “Amber Brown.” “It’s just a fun, feel-good family dramedy. There is heart, love, sadness, tension, and comedy in it, and it is all wrapped into a beautiful little story.”

“I think it’s going to be a beautiful show that people can see and relate to, and hopefully, it can get people talking,” he added.

‘The Bold and The Beautiful’

Darin Brooks also stars as Wyatt Spencer in the popular CBS soap opera “The Bold and The Beautiful.” Last year, in 2021, he scored an Emmy nomination for “Outstanding Supporting Actor in a Drama Series.” “That was amazing, I was happy about that one because the competition is so stiff,” he said. “I was very happy to finally get nominated for my acting work on ‘The Bold and The Beautiful’.”

He was so thrilled for co-star John McCook for winning the 2022 Daytime Emmy Award for “Outstanding Lead Actor in a Drama Series.” “John is such a good soul and he loves the show, the people, and what he does. He is the dad on the set and off the set. I was so over the moon to watch him win,” Brooks said.

“I am also happy Aaron D. Spears got nominated this year, he killed it in his storyline this year. Aaron was great, and I really loved his scenes with Don Diamont,” he said.
